Septic Effluent Pump Repair

Many onsite systems cannot move effluent to the treatment area by gravity alone, so they use a pump. When that pump, its floats or its controls fail, effluent stops leaving the pump tank — and the alarm is the system telling you before the house does.

What the alarm means

A high-level alarm indicates that liquid in the pump tank has risen above its normal operating range. That could be a failed pump, a stuck float, a tripped breaker, a wiring or control panel fault, or a restriction downstream that prevents effluent from being accepted by the treatment area.

Common symptoms

  • Audible alarm or a lit alarm indicator on a control panel.
  • A breaker for the septic pump that trips repeatedly.
  • Effluent surfacing near the pump tank.
  • Slow drains or backups on a system that previously worked normally.
  • A pump that runs constantly, or that never seems to run at all.

Possible causes

CauseTypical repair
Failed pump motor or impellerPump replacement
Stuck, tangled or failed float switchFloat replacement or re-hanging
Tripped breaker or GFCIElectrical fault investigation, then reset or repair
Control panel or wiring faultComponent repair or panel replacement
Check valve or discharge line blockageClearing or replacing the affected part
Downstream treatment area not accepting effluentInvestigation of the field — the pump may be a symptom, not the cause

That last row matters. A pump that keeps alarming after being replaced may be working perfectly while the soil treatment area refuses to accept what it is sending. Replacing pumps repeatedly without checking the field is an expensive way to postpone a diagnosis.

Cost factors

  • Whether the fault is the pump, a float, the panel or the discharge line.
  • Pump size and specification for the system's design.
  • Depth of the pump tank and ease of access.
  • Whether electrical work is required.
  • Whether the control panel also needs replacing.
  • Whether the underlying issue turns out to be the treatment area.

Pump and control repairs generally sit in the lower band of septic costs — often somewhere around $500–$2,500 as planning context — unless the investigation points to the treatment area.

Can I silence the alarm and deal with it later?

Silencing the audible alarm is normal and reasonable. Ignoring the condition is not — the tank has only limited capacity above the alarm point, and effluent will eventually back up or surface.

Can I replace the pump myself?

Pump tanks carry serious gas and electrical hazards, and matching the correct pump specification to the system's design matters. This is work for a qualified septic professional.

How long does a septic effluent pump last?

Service life varies with usage, water quality and installation. Treat symptoms and inspection findings as the guide rather than a fixed number of years.
